How Panel Acoustic Walls Function to Absorb Sound

Panel acoustic walls play a vital role in improving sound quality within various spaces. They are designed to absorb sound waves, reducing echo and background noise. The materials used in these panels are specially formulated to dampen sound rather than reflect it. This is crucial in environments like offices, schools, and recording studios, where clarity is essential.

When sound waves hit a panel, they penetrate the surface and are trapped within the material. This process converts sound energy into a small amount of heat. The thicker the panel, the more effective it can be at absorbing lower frequencies. However, not all surfaces absorb sound effectively. Some areas may still require additional treatment for optimal results.

Installing panel acoustic walls may seem straightforward, but placement is crucial. Strategic positioning can enhance their effectiveness. It’s important to consider room layout, furniture, and existing surfaces. Some users may find that certain panels do not work as expected in their unique spaces, leading to mixed results. Experimentation and adjustment may be necessary to achieve the desired sound control.

Comparing Different Types of Acoustic Panel Materials

When selecting acoustic panels, material choice matters significantly. There are various types, each with unique characteristics affecting sound quality. Fabric-wrapped panels are popular for their aesthetic appeal and customization options. They can blend seamlessly with room designs while effectively absorbing sound. However, they might not be as durable as other materials, requiring more frequent replacements or maintenance.

On the other hand, wood acoustic panels offer a natural look and sound absorption. The warmth of wood creates a pleasant atmosphere in any space. However, they can be heavier and more difficult to install. This is something to consider for DIY projects. Additionally, foam panels are lightweight and cost-effective. They provide good sound absorption but can sometimes lack durability, depending on their quality.

Choosing the right material for acoustic panels involves balancing aesthetics, cost, and functionality. Each option has its trade-offs. Assessing your specific needs and environment is crucial. This reflection can enhance your space's acoustics while ensuring your choices align with your desired style.
